The Ultimate Move-Out Cleaning Checklist

Here's an exhaustive list damaged down by area:

Living Areas

Dust all surface areas consisting of racks and baseboards. Clean windows and window sills. Vacuum carpetings or wipe floors. Wipe down light fixtures.

Bedrooms

Dust furnishings thoroughly. Clean under beds and behind furniture. Wash curtains if applicable.

Bathrooms

Scrub bathrooms, bathtubs, and sinks using disinfectants. Wipe down mirrors until streak-free. Mop floors thoroughly.

Kitchen

Clean out fridge (do not fail to remember those hidden corners!). Wipe down cabinets inside and out. Scrub kitchen counters with ideal cleaners.

Storage Spaces

Remove things and dust shelves. Ensure every little thing is cleaned out completely.

FAQs About Move-Out Cleaning

1. What need to I do first when I begin my move-out cleaning?

You must begin by getting rid of all individual valuables so that you have clear accessibility to all surfaces that require cleaning.

2. For how long does move-out cleansing generally take?

The period depends on the dimension of your residential property but normally varies from 4 to 8 hours for a typical apartment.

3. Can I take care of move-out cleaning myself?

Absolutely! With correct preparation and organization, managing it on your own can save money while being rewarding!

4. What occurs if I avoid move-out cleaning?

Skipping this essential step might bring about deductions from your down payment or a miserable property manager regarding cleanliness.

5. Is it worth employing professionals?

If you have actually limited time or choose peace of mind knowing specialists manage it, working with professionals can be worth every penny!

6. Should I clean appliances like ovens or refrigerators?

Yes! These are typically high-impact locations that property owners look at carefully throughout inspections.
